Stress Washing Timber Surfaces
When pressure cleaning wood surface areas, it's important to choose the ideal devices and technique to prevent damages. A reduced pressure, generally between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is ideal for wood. This assists avoid gouging or removing the timber fibers.
Before you start, see to it to clear the location of furniture, plants, and various other barriers. It's essential to check a tiny, inconspicuous section first to guarantee your method and pressure settings won't hurt the surface area.
Make use of a fan nozzle accessory for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at least 12 inches away from the wood to minimize the threat of damages.
As you wash, move in long, sweeping activities along the grain of the wood. This method aids raise dirt and debris effectively without leaving touches.
After washing, wash the surface area thoroughly to eliminate any continuing to be cleansing remedy. Permit the timber to dry completely before applying any kind of sealant or discolor. Complying with these actions will certainly ensure your wood surfaces stay in terrific problem while looking fresh and clean.
Techniques for Cleaning Concrete
Concrete surfaces can collect dust, gunk, and spots with time, making effective cleansing techniques vital. To begin, you'll wish to use a pressure wash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leansing. This degree of stress efficiently removes persistent stains without damaging the surface.
Before you start, spray the area with a concrete cleaner or a mix of cleaning agent and water. Permit it to dwell for regarding 10-15 mins; this assists break down hard stains.
Next off, connect a large spray nozzle to your pressure washing machine, preferably a 25-degree or 40-degree suggestion. This will certainly disperse the water uniformly and minimize the threat of etching.
When you start pressure cleaning, operate in areas. Maintain the nozzle about 12 inches from the surface area and preserve a stable, sweeping motion. This strategy ensures you don't miss any kind of spots or use excessive stress in one area.
For especially persistent spots, you may require to repeat the procedure or use an extra focused cleaner.
Finally, wash the area completely after cleaning. This action prevents any type of residue from staying on the concrete, leaving it tidy and looking fresh.
Best Practices for Plastic Siding
Plastic siding is a popular option for home owners because of its resilience and reduced maintenance needs. Nonetheless, to keep it looking its finest, you'll need to push clean it regularly.
Begin by preparing the area-- get rid of any type of furniture, plants, or obstacles near your home. Next, pick a stress washer with a nozzle that delivers a vast spray; commonly, a 25-degree nozzle works well.
Before you start, check a tiny section to ensure your settings won't harm the exterior siding. Keep the pressure below 2000 PSI to stay clear of any type of dents or fractures. Start from the bottom and work your way up, cleaning in sections to prevent streaks.
Make use of a detergent especially formulated for vinyl exterior siding to assist get rid of dirt and mold. Use it with your stress washing machine or a pump sprayer, allowing it to sit for around 10 minutes.
